DRINKS company Britvic today reported like-for-like revenue growth of 29.3 per cent to £935 million for the 52 weeks to September.
The company, the UK bottler for PepsiCo Inc soft drinks, reported growth in key markets, including squash, juice drinks, water and sports drinks.
The stills market, up 4.8 per cent, saw strong sales of Fruit Shoot and Robinsons squash in the UK, as well as the launch of new products Gatorade and Drench.
Chief Executive Paul Moody said: "We have delivered a strong performance despite the disappointing weather."
